关于算法:SPSS中的多层等级线性模型Multilevel-linear-models研究整容手术数据

原文链接:http://tecdat.cn/?p=12761


咱们应用整容手术数据阐明两种中心化类型。将此文件加载到SPSS中。假如咱们要中心化的变量BDI。

数据中心化

首先,咱们须要找出BDI的均匀得分。咱们能够应用一些简略的描述性统计信息。抉择进入对话框。抉择BDI并将其拖到标有Variable(s)的框中,而后单击并仅抉择均值。

后果输入通知咱们平均值为23.05:

咱们应用此值将变量中心化。通过抉择拜访计算命令。在呈现的对话框中,在标有“指标变量”的框中输出名称BDI_Centred,而后单击并为变量指定一个更具描述性的名称。抉择变量BDI并将其拖动到标记为Numeric Expression的区域,而后单击,而后键入平均值(23.05)。实现的对话框如图所示。

单击,将创立一个名为BDI_Centred的新变量,该变量以BDI的平均值为核心。这个新变量的均值应约为0:运行一些描述性统计数据。

能够在语法窗口中通过输出以下内容执行雷同的操作:

COMPUTE BDI_Centred = BDI−23.05.
EXECUTE.

组均值中心化

组均值中心化要简单得多。第一步是创立一个蕴含组均值的文件。让咱们再试一次以获取BDI分数。咱们心愿将此变量在Clinic的2级变量中中心化。咱们首先须要晓得每个组中的均匀BDI,并以SPSS模式保留该信息。咱们要应用aggregate命令。在此对话框(图3)中,咱们要抉择Clinic并将其拖动到标有Break Variable(s)的区域。这阐明着将应用变量Clinic来宰割数据文件(换句话说,当计算平均值时,它将对每个诊所别离进行解决)。而后,咱们须要抉择BDI并将其拖动到标记为变量汇总的区域。一旦抉择了此变量,默认值就是SPSS将创立一个名为BDI_mean的新变量,这是BDI的平均值(显然是由Clinic宰割)。咱们须要将此信息保留在一个文件中,以便当前应用。

默认状况下,SPSS会将名称为aggr.sav的文件保留在默认目录中。如果您想将其保留在其余地位或应用其余名称,则单击以关上一个一般的文件系统对话框,能够在其中命名文件并导航至要保留在其中的目录。单击创立此新文件。

如果关上生成的数据文件,则会看到它仅蕴含两列,其中一列带有一个数字,用于指定数据来自的诊所(共有10个诊所),第二个蕴含每个诊所内的均匀BDI得分。

当SPSS创立汇总数据文件时,它将按从最低到最高的程序对诊所进行排序(无论它们在数据集中的程序如何)。因而,为了使咱们的工作数据文件与该聚合文件匹配,咱们须要确保从诊所1到诊所10也订购了来自各个诊所的所有数据。这能够通过应用sort cases命令轻松实现。

要拜访sort cases命令,请抉择select。呈现的对话框如图所示。抉择您要对文件进行排序的变量(在本例中为Clinic),并将其拖动到标有“排序根据”的区域(或单击)。能够抉择按升序排列文件(诊所1到诊所10),或降序排列(返回诊所1的诊所10)。单击对文件排序。

下一步是在汇总文件中应用这些临床办法,以将BDI变量放在咱们的主文件中。为此,咱们须要应用match files命令,能够通过抉择进行拜访。这将关上一个对话框,其中列出了所有关上的数据文件(在我的状况下,除了我正在工作的文件之外,其余所有文件都没有关上,因而该空间为空白)或询问您抉择SPSS数据文件。单击并导航到您决定存储聚合值文件的地位(在我的状况下为aggr.sav)。抉择此文件,而后单击以返回到对话框。而后单击进入下一个对话框。

在下一个对话框中,咱们须要匹配两个文件,这只是通知SPSS两个文件已连贯。为此,请单击。而后,咱们还须要专门连贯Clinic变量上的文件。为此,select通知SPSS有效的数据集(即,汇总分数文件)应视为与要害变量上的工作数据文件匹配的值表。咱们须要抉择此要害变量是什么。咱们要匹配Clinic变量上的文件,因而在“排除的变量”列表中抉择此变量,并将其拖到标有“要害变量”的空间(或单击)。

 数据编辑器当初应蕴含一个新变量BDI\_mean,其中蕴含咱们文件aggr.sav中的值。基本上,SPSS已匹配诊所变量的文件,因而BDI\_mean中的值对应于各个诊所的平均值。因而,当临床变量为1时,BDI\_mean已设置为25.19,然而当临床变量为2时,BDI\_mean已设置为31.32。咱们能够再次在compute命令中应用这些值来使BDI中心化。通过抉择拜访计算命令。在呈现的对话框(图7)中,在标有“指标变量”的框中输出名称BDI\_Group\_Centred,而后单击并为变量指定一个更具描述性的名称。抉择变量BDI并将其拖到标有“数字表达式”的区域,而后单击,而后键入“ BDI_mean”或抉择此变量并将其拖到标有“指标变量”的框中。单击,将创立一个新变量,其中蕴含以组为核心的均值。

另外,能够应用以下语法来实现所有操作:

AGGREGATE
 /OUTFILE='C:\\Users\\Dr. Andy Field\\Documents\\Academic\\Data\\aggr.sav'
 /BREAK=Clinic
 /BDI_mean=MEAN(BDI).
SORT CASES BY Clinic(A).
MATCH FILES /FILE=*
 /TABLE='C:\\Users\\Dr. Andy Field\\Documents\\Academic\\Data\\aggr.sav'
 /BY Clinic.
EXECUTE.
COMPUTE BDI\_Group\_Centred=BDI − BDI_mean.
EXECUTE.

要拜访“重组数据向导”,请抉择。向导中的步骤如图所示。在第一个对话框中,您须要说是否要将变量转换为案例,还是将案例转换为变量。咱们在不同的列(变量)中具备不同的工夫级别,并且心愿它们在不同的行(案例)中,因而咱们须要抉择。单击以移至下一个对话框。该对话框询问您是要从旧数据文件的不同列中在新数据文件中仅创立一个新变量,还是要创立多个新变量。

在咱们的案例中,咱们将创立一个代表生存满意度的变量。默认,SPSS在新数据文件中创立一个名为id的变量,该变量告诉您数据来自哪个样本(即原始数据文件的哪一行)。它通过应用原始数据文件中的案例编号来实现。而后从数据文件中抉择一个变量以充当新数据文件中的标签。

其余对话框非常简单。接下来的两个解决索引变量。SPSS创立一个新变量,该变量将通知你数据源自哪一列。在咱们有四个工夫点的状况下,这将意味着变量只是一个从1到4的数字序列。

多层(等级)线性模型

将BDI,年龄和性别包含在内作为固定成果预测指标。

抉择 ,而后通过从变量列表中抉择Clinic并将其拖动到标有Subjects的框中来指定 变量(或单击)。

单击以移至主对话框 。首先,咱们必须指定后果变量,即手术后的生存品质(QoL),因而抉择Post_QoL并将其拖动到标有因变量的空间(或单击)。

咱们须要将预测变量作为固定效应增加到咱们的模型中,因而单击,按住Ctrl并在标记为Factors和Covariates的列表中抉择Base_QoL,Surgery,Age,性别,Reason和BDI。

当初,咱们须要申请随机截距和随机斜率以达到手术成果。

单击并抉择。单击以返回到主对话框。在主对话框中,单击并申请参数估计和协方差参数的测验。单击以返回到主对话框。要运行剖析。输入如下:

就此新模型的整体拟合而言,咱们能够应用对数似然统计:

卡方统计的临界值为7.81(p <.05,df = 3);因而,这一变动意义重大。包含这三个预测变量能够改善模型的拟合度。年龄,F(1,150.83)= 37.32,p <.001,BDI,F(1,260.83)= 16.74,p <.001,显着预测了手术后的生存品质,但性别没有,F(1,264.48 )= 0.90,p = 0.34。包含这些因素的次要区别在于,Reason的次要影响变得不显着,并且Reason×Surgery交互作用变得更加重要(其b从4.22,p = .013变为5.02,p = .001)。

咱们能够通过拆分并运行更简略的剖析来合成此交互,如本文所述(没有交互和Reason的次要影响,但包含Base_QoL,Surgery,BDI,Age和Gender)。如果进行这些剖析,将取得输入中所示的参数表。对于那些只为扭转外观而进行手术的患者,手术显着预测了手术后的生存品质,b = –3.16,t(5.25)= –2.63,p = .04。与不包含年龄,性别和BDI的状况不同,这种影响当初很显著。负系数表明,与对照组相比,这些人的手术后生存品质较低。然而,对于那些通过手术解决身材问题的人,手术并不能显着预测生存品质,b = 0.67,t(10.59)= 0.58,p = 0.57。从实质上讲,年龄,性别和BDI的纳入对后一组简直没有什么影响。然而,该斜率是正的,表明承受手术医治的人的生存品质得分比等待名单上的得分高(只管不是很显著!)。因而,相互作用的影响反映了在进行身材问题手术的患者(轻微的正斜率)和仅出于虚荣心进行手术的患者(负的斜率)中手术斜率作为生存品质预测指标的差别。

扭转外貌的手术

身材问题的手术

【腾讯云】轻量 2核2G4M,首年65元

阿里云限时活动-云数据库 RDS MySQL  1核2G配置 1.88/月 速抢

本文由乐趣区整理发布,转载请注明出处,谢谢。

您可能还喜欢...

发表回复

您的电子邮箱地址不会被公开。 必填项已用*标注

此站点使用Akismet来减少垃圾评论。了解我们如何处理您的评论数据